[PATCH] m68k/sun3: Use %pM format specifier to print ethernet address

printk() supports %pM format specifier for printing 6-byte MAC/FDDI
addresses in hex notation small buffers, let's use it intead of %x:%x...

Signed-off-by: Alexander Kuleshov <kuleshovmail@xxxxxxxxx>
---
 arch/m68k/sun3/idprom.c | 5 +----
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/m68k/sun3/idprom.c b/arch/m68k/sun3/idprom.c
index c86ac37..cfe9aa4 100644
--- a/arch/m68k/sun3/idprom.c
+++ b/arch/m68k/sun3/idprom.c
@@ -125,8 +125,5 @@ void __init idprom_init(void)
 
 	display_system_type(idprom->id_machtype);
 
-	printk("Ethernet address: %x:%x:%x:%x:%x:%x\n",
-		    idprom->id_ethaddr[0], idprom->id_ethaddr[1],
-		    idprom->id_ethaddr[2], idprom->id_ethaddr[3],
-		    idprom->id_ethaddr[4], idprom->id_ethaddr[5]);
+	printk("Ethernet address: %pM\n", idprom->id_ethaddr);
 }
